β€” Is it difficult to be a clan leader?
β€” It's definitely difficult.

CL's day is scheduled from early morning (or night) until late evening.

My prime time varies from 12 to 16 hours.

There are practically no days off at all. Only between projects.

Definitely, you need to cope with multitasking, starting from side advertising (discords, telegram, streams), ending with recruiting, personal communication with each member, working with the DKP system and leading many thousands of fights for bosses or spots.


β€” What difficulties do you face? And how do you overcome these difficulties?
β€” Over a 6-year career, there is occasional burnout (as in any job), which can be dealt with through physical activity and fresh air (we line workers rarely go outside).

People's lack of clarity and unclear reasons.

Today a player is in a clan and everything is fine with him, and tomorrow he leaves without explanation, although I have given him due attention. In such situations, I try to prolong communication with the person as much as possible, to fully understand his problem, and try to solve it. Many banal situations are closed by primitive psychology and communication.

Any negative moments on the project or in the clan that are completely beyond my control (member/pack quit the game because of negative situations from the server). In this case, the main thing is to quickly switch to a positive mood and not get hung up on the situation.

β€” You have shown yourself as a good RL, who can win the installation on a good resource "people". You are also involved in the clan economy, recruiting and your own pack. In my opinion, there are too many responsibilities for one person... Maybe you should delegate some of the responsibility and unload yourself?
β€” Delegation is an important aspect of any project. I understand this, but with my interest in everything and the slogan "if you want to do something well - do it yourself", it is difficult to find specific people to whom I would entrust some of the tasks. This is not good, but I would gladly delegate tasks related to the clan economy (maintaining the DKP system, the market, maintaining the clan balance), as well as recruiting - it would also be nice to find an interested person who, like me, would actively write to the players of the project where we play. As for RL - this is my favorite part of the work, which I would delegate only for a few days a month in order to spend time with my family and reboot a little.
